Output 34d20c30d2062e53b259bd68c5ca75ed704c164f5642c8f1943d5c74f0a0ca95:0

value
72166166
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 86acf58eea4c82c1f94de114f5c2bccc7c1beb22 OP_EQUALVERIFY OP_CHECKSIG
address
1DH6k85RETyuWbiFT69b6ohNycf3RehMJT
transaction
34d20c30d2062e53b259bd68c5ca75ed704c164f5642c8f1943d5c74f0a0ca95
spent
true